The India U19 team stormed into the final of the ICC U19 World Cup 2026 after defeating Afghanistan U19 by seven wickets in the second semi-final at the Harare Sports Club on Wednesday. Chasing a daunting target of 311 runs, the Ayush Mhatre-led side produced the highest successful run chase in U19 World Cup history, underlining their dominance on the global stage.

India’s emphatic victory sets up a title clash against England U19, who earlier defeated defending champions Australia in the first semi-final. The final will be played in Harare on Friday.

India’s chase was anchored by a superb century from opener Aaron George, who struck 115 off 104 balls, including 15 fours and two sixes. He provided the backbone of the innings as India methodically dismantled Afghanistan’s bowling attack.

George added 90 runs for the opening wicket with Vaibhav Sooryavanshi, whose explosive 68 off just 33 balls gave India early momentum. The aggressive start ensured that the required run rate never spiralled out of control.

Later, Vihaan Malhotra remained unbeaten on 38 off 47 balls, while Vedant Trivedi finished the chase with five not out, as India reached the target with overs to spare.

Afghanistan’s Nooristani Omarzai was the most effective bowler, returning figures of 2 for 64 from his full quota of 10 overs, but lacked support from the rest of the attack.

Afghanistan’s Centuries Set Stiff Target

Earlier, Afghanistan posted a competitive 310 for 4 after opting to bat first, riding on centuries from Faisal Shinozada and Uzairullah Niazai. The duo stitched together a commanding 148-run partnership, putting India under early pressure.

Shinozada played a fluent knock of 110 off 93 balls, striking 15 boundaries, while Niazai remained unbeaten on 101 off 86 deliveries, which included 12 fours and two sixes. Afghanistan crossed the 200-run mark in the 41st over and accelerated sharply at the death.

Shinozada reached his century in 86 balls and became the first Afghanistan batter to score a U19 World Cup hundred against India, joining an elite list that includes Malcolm Lake, Tagenarine Chanderpaul, and Ben Stokes.

Indian Bowlers Strike at Key Moments

Despite the onslaught, India’s bowlers managed to pull things back at crucial intervals. Deepesh Devendran and Kanishk Chouhan picked up two wickets each, conceding 64 and 55 runs respectively, to prevent Afghanistan from pushing beyond 320.

Devendran broke both the opening stand and the crucial Shinozada-Niazai partnership, while Chouhan dismissed Osman Sadat to halt Afghanistan’s momentum in the middle overs.

India Eye Record Sixth U19 World Cup Title

With this victory, India U19 remain on course for a record-extending sixth Under-19 World Cup title. The final against England promises a high-stakes contest between two of the tournament’s most consistent sides.

England booked their place in the final after defeating Australia U19, setting up a marquee clash as India look to cap off their campaign with silverware.